## Environments — telemetry compression

Plinth runs three environments: dev, staging, and prod. Plugin authors should note that telemetry payloads are compressed before leaving the agent in staging and prod, but sent uncompressed in dev to ease debugging. The agent negotiates the codec per connection, falling back to plain JSON if the collector rejects the handshake. To match an environment's behavior locally, apply the configuration values shown below.

config for tajof-yaguf:
[istox]
team = aldius
access_code = ac_29be1b
owner = holok.praix
host = istox.zarqelsoft.test
port = 11211
peer = novath.olvarqio.example
salt = 983a9dc6
pin = 4652

TICKET: Fan-out backpressure drift on notify-relay. Staging and prod disagree on queue depth caps after last week's hotfix; prod still runs the old shed threshold, so bursts from the Pingwick campaign tool back up into the dispatcher. Two pagers fired, no user impact confirmed. Fix is to realign prod with the reviewed baseline before Thursday. Current prod values as pulled this morning are below.

config for bagep-kageg:
ULADOR_LOG_LEVEL=warn
ULADOR_METRICS_HOST=metrics.ulador.tolvaqcorp.corp
ULADOR_POOL_SIZE=32

The Proselint-Q documentation linter runs hourly against the Hallowgrange docs repo. Its behavior is controlled through DOCLINT_RULESET and DOCLINT_STRICT, both safe to adjust during an incident. Publishing lint reports to the internal dashboard, however, requires an authenticated upload token. If reports stop appearing, verify that the worker's .env contains the following line:

secret setting of hawep-yahig: LEDGER_TOKEN29=41b5d6315371c92885eaeb077fb63

## Authentication

Vendored fonts for the Saltgrass UI live under `assets/fonts/vendor`. Do not fetch them at build time. To update, pull from the Typeflute mirror using the sync script; it refuses anonymous requests. Licensing manifests must be regenerated after every sync or CI fails. The sync script expects an auth header on every request and reads the token directly below this section.

portal login ticket: eyJhbGciOiJIUzI1NiIsInR5cCI6IkpXVCJ9.eyJzdWIiOiIMjvRAf3PEFIn0.nuv9gjixLtnr